How much does it cost to rent a home in Buckner?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Buckner 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,915 | $1,200 | $3,719 |
Buckner 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,279 | $1,350 | $5,000 |
Buckner 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,772 | $2,550 | $4,750 |
Buckner 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,225 | $3,500 | $4,950 |
Buckner 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,250 | $6,250 | $6,250 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Buckner
What type of rentals are currently available in Buckner?
There are currently 41 Apartments for Rent in Buckner, KY with pricing that ranges from $810 to $4,214. There are also 38 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Buckner ranging from $1,200 to $6,250.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Buckner?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Buckner ranges from $1,200 to $6,250 with an average monthly rent of $3,688.
